Note that as of today, the name of the kit is changing from FreePDK14 to FreePDK15, in order to maintain consistency with the NanGate Open Cell Library release. This version of the kit includes the technology library for Cadence Virtuoso and Synopsys P圜ell and design rules for Mentor Graphics Calibre.
